There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Augusta-Richmond County consolidated government (balance) is 26.2% cheaper than South Fulton. With a cost index of 78 vs 106,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Augusta-Richmond County consolidated government (balance) to South Fulton should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Augusta-Richmond County consolidated government (balance) is $1,087/month compared to $1,607/month in South Fulton — a 32%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Augusta-Richmond County consolidated government (balance) is more affordable at $162,900 median vs $270,600.

Median household income in Augusta-Richmond County consolidated government (balance) is $53,134 compared to $81,798 in South Fulton (-35%). While South Fulton is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Augusta-Richmond County consolidated government (balance) spend roughly 24.5% of their income on rent, more than the 23.6% in South Fulton.
